#include using namespace std; int main() { int N, K, Ans = 0; cin >> N >> K; vector A(N); for (int &a : A) cin >> a; auto solve = [&](auto solve, int X, int Y, long long S) -> void { if (X == K) { if (S % 998244353 <= S % 993) Ans++; return; } for (int i = Y + 1; i < N; i++) solve(solve, X + 1, i, S + A.at(i)); }; solve(solve, 0, -1, 0); cout << Ans % 998 << endl; }